11 help
12 The "Serial Peripheral Interface" is a low level synchronous
13 protocol. Chips that support SPI can have data transfer rates
14 up to several tens of Mbit/sec. Chips are addressed with a
15 controller and a chipselect. Most SPI slaves don't support
16 dynamic device discovery; some are even write-only or read-only.
17
3cb2fccc 18 SPI is widely used by microcontrollers to talk with sensors,
8ae12a0d
DB
19 eeprom and flash memory, codecs and various other controller
20 chips, analog to digital (and d-to-a) converters, and more.
21 MMC and SD cards can be accessed using SPI protocol; and for
22 DataFlash cards used in MMC sockets, SPI must always be used.
23
24 SPI is one of a family of similar protocols using a four wire
25 interface (select, clock, data in, data out) including Microwire
26 (half duplex), SSP, SSI, and PSP. This driver framework should
27 work with most such devices and controllers.

9904f22a 103config SPI_BITBANG
d29389de 104 tristate "Utilities for Bitbanging SPI masters"
9904f22a
DB
105 help
106 With a few GPIO pins, your system can bitbang the SPI protocol.
107 Select this to get SPI support through I/O pins (GPIO, parallel
108 port, etc). Or, some systems' SPI master controller drivers use
109 this code to manage the per-word or per-transfer accesses to the
110 hardware shift registers.
111
112 This is library code, and is automatically selected by drivers that
113 need it. You only need to select this explicitly to support driver
114 modules that aren't part of this kernel tree.

164config SPI_GPIO
165 tristate "GPIO-based bitbanging SPI Master"
166 depends on GENERIC_GPIO
167 select SPI_BITBANG
168 help
169 This simple GPIO bitbanging SPI master uses the arch-neutral GPIO
170 interface to manage MOSI, MISO, SCK, and chipselect signals. SPI
171 slaves connected to a bus using this driver are configured as usual,
172 except that the spi_board_info.controller_data holds the GPIO number
173 for the chipselect used by this controller driver.
174
175 Note that this driver often won't achieve even 1 Mbit/sec speeds,
176 making it unusually slow for SPI. If your platform can inline
177 GPIO operations, you should be able to leverage that for better
178 speed with a custom version of this driver; see the source code.

336config SPI_S3C24XX_FIQ
337 bool "S3C24XX driver with FIQ pseudo-DMA"
338 depends on SPI_S3C24XX
339 select FIQ
340 help
341 Enable FIQ support for the S3C24XX SPI driver to provide pseudo
342 DMA by using the fast-interrupt request framework, This allows
343 the driver to get DMA-like performance when there are either
344 no free DMA channels, or when doing transfers that required both
345 TX and RX data paths.
